Now it won’t be so easy to lie about having the flu! That’s because a group of scientists have developed a Artificial intelligence that recognizes the voices of people with the flu.
Obviously, the main goal of this technology is not to identify lying employees, but to reduce the number of people seeking medical care. Initially, the equipment is intended to detect signs and symptoms of flu, but in the future, the idea is to expand its use to other health conditions.

Experts explain that the investigation is carried out through the harmonic tones of our voice, which decrease in amplitude as the frequency increases. When we are infected by a virus, this pattern of voice tones changes.
The results of the project were found from the analysis of approximately 630 people, of which 111 were diagnosed with flu confirmed by a doctor.
During the call, a few commands were given. The first was for participants to count from 1 to 40. Then, they were asked to tell a story. At this point, all the algorithms included in the system contained the information necessary for the machine to understand the difference between the tones of voice with and without the flu.
The collection process is still ongoing, but with some results being analyzed, researchers are already very happy with the system. This is because it has already shown significant results, since Artificial Intelligence has so far detected 70% of the cases, which is great for the testing phase.
